2 servings of about 3/4 cup each 230 calories per serving
Beef cubes, from
chuck steak*
about 1 cup
Tomatoes
half of a 16-ounce can
(about 1 cup)
Garlic powder
1/8 teaspoon dash
Pepper
dash
Onion, sliced
1 small
Green pepper,
cut in 1-inch pieces 1/2 medium
1. Brown beef cubes in saucepan until well browned
2. Break up large pieces of tomatoes. Stir in garlic
powder and pepper. Pour over beef. Cover and cook over
low heat until beef is almost tender-about 1 hour.
3. Add onion and green pepper. Cover and continue cooking
until vegetables and beef are tender--about 30 minutes.
*NOTE: For beef cubes, use a 1-1/2 pound blade chuck
steak. Separate lean meat from fat and bone. Cut meat into
3/4-inch cubes. Divide beef cubes in half. rise half
(about 1 cup) for Beef and Peppers. Save remaining 1 cup
for Braised Beef with Noodles.
